Online Bachelor’s Degrees Offered at Saint Mary’s University of Minnesota
Saint Mary’s University of Minnesota offers over 80 programs at all levels of education, from bachelor’s and certificate programs to doctoral degrees. A growing number of these are available online. The digital format allows you to learn from anywhere with an adaptable schedule, helping you balance education with other obligations. Browse our online degree offerings below:
Accounting
With our online Accounting degree, you’ll develop robust skills in financial analysis, strategic planning, and decision-making under faculty with real-world experience. After earning your degree, pursue credentials like Certified Public Accountant (CPA) or Certified Management Accountant (CMA).
Applied Psychology
If you aspire to a career in counseling or healthcare, you can’t do better than Minnesota’s largest university program for mental health. Our online Applied Psychology degree program applies the same standards of excellence to exploring human behavior and its applications in real-world settings.
Business Administration
Prepare to lead in a dynamic business environment by completing an online Business Administration program. Our degree program centers on developing foundational business skills for both corporate and nonprofit settings while strengthening your communication and decision-making abilities.
Criminal Justice Leadership
The online Criminal Justice Leadership program helps you take the next step in your career in law enforcement, corrections, or public safety. Learn advanced skills in ethical leadership, communication, and management, taught by current or recently retired professionals with real-world insight.
Healthcare Management
Effective administration is crucial for life-saving healthcare. Prepare yourself to step into this role with an online Healthcare Management degree. Through our program, you will develop analytical and leadership skills with respect for sociocultural diversity, preparing you for an ever-changing healthcare environment.
Human Resource Management
Pursue a career in business or elevate your current one with a degree in Human Resource Management. Our online program combines human resource principles with foundational business knowledge, preparing you to manage and lead employees in compliance with labor laws and regulations.
Information Technology
Today’s tech industry is constantly evolving; learn to keep up with an online Information Technology degree. This program provides a broad foundation in operating systems, network administration, cybersecurity, cloud computing, database management, and much more, applicable to a variety of roles.
Special Education
If you have a passion for children, a degree in Special Education may be right for you. Our online program provides valuable hands-on experience alongside courses in lesson planning, behavior management, individualized instruction, and other skills that are essential for success in the classroom.
Frequently Asked Questions About Online Bachelor’s Degrees
Why get an online bachelor’s degree?
Earning a bachelor’s degree can enhance your career, opening the door to new or more specialized opportunities. Studying online provides the flexibility to pursue this goal alongside your working schedule or other responsibilities.
How long does an online bachelor’s degree take to earn?
Most online programs at Saint Mary’s University of Minnesota take about two years to complete. Transfer credits or an accelerated degree plan can help you graduate sooner.
How do I learn more about financial aid options?
To learn more about financial aid at Saint Mary’s University of Minnesota, complete the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) and get in touch with a financial aid advisor.
Can I transfer credits if I’ve already started my degree at another college?
Yes. Saint Mary’s University of Minnesota has a generous credit transfer policy that accepts most credits from an accredited institution.
